Cluster Assistant Learning & Development Manager
Posted Updated
Responsible for planning, coordinating, and implementing Learning & Development activities across the assigned hotels under the Human Resources Department. The role oversees training needs analysis, onboarding, mandatory training, employee development, training records, reporting, and Hilton learning platforms. Works closely with hotel leadership and department heads to ensure effective training delivery and support continuous learning and career development.
- Lead and coordinate all Learning & Development (L&D) activities across the assigned hotels.
- Develop and implement the annual L&D plan in alignment with business needs.
- Coordinate and deliver new joiner onboarding and orientation programs.
- Monitor completion of mandatory, compliance, and brand-specific training.
- Maintain accurate and up-to-date training records, attendance, and documentation.
- Prepare monthly L&D reports and KPIs for HR management.
- Manage and monitor Hilton learning platforms and digital training programs.
- Coordinate with internal and external trainers and training providers.
- Support employee development, career development, and succession planning initiatives.
- Manage and follow up on internship, Tamheer, and trainee programs.
- Organize workshops, career fairs, development events, and university partnerships.
- Conduct training sessions and facilitate learning and development activities as required.
- Evaluate training effectiveness and implement necessary improvement actions.
- Promote a strong learning and development culture across the hotels.
- Ensure compliance with Hilton standards, policies, and HR requirements.
- Perform other HR and L&D duties as assigned.
